Political factors
Trade tariffs significantly influence Focusrite's costs. For instance, tariffs on electronic components from China could raise production expenses. Changes in UK-EU trade post-Brexit also impact Focusrite. In 2024, the UK's import tariffs averaged around 2.5%, affecting Focusrite's component costs. These policies force adjustments in pricing and sourcing.
Political instability and geopolitical tensions can significantly impact Focusrite. Disruptions in supply chains, like those experienced in 2022, can hinder production. Consumer confidence, crucial for sales, can plummet amid uncertainty. For example, in 2024, the Russia-Ukraine war continues to impact global markets. Focusrite's global reach exposes it to these risks across several regions.
Government backing significantly impacts the arts and music sector, affecting audio equipment demand. Funding for music education and cultural institutions can boost Focusrite's customer base. In 2024, the UK government allocated £1.57 billion to support arts and culture. Policy shifts influence market size and growth.
Taxation Policies
Taxation policies significantly influence Focusrite's profitability. Changes in corporate tax rates directly affect the company's bottom line. Import duties on components and finished products can increase production costs. Any tax incentives or penalties in key markets also play a role.
- UK corporate tax rate: 25% (2024), unchanged.
- US corporate tax: 21%, with state variations.
- EU import tariffs: Vary by product category.
These factors influence Focusrite's pricing strategies and investment choices. Understanding these tax implications is crucial for financial planning.

Economic factors
Inflation and the cost of living directly affect consumer spending habits. High inflation rates, such as the 3.1% reported in January 2024 in the US, can lead to decreased spending on non-essential items. This could reduce demand for Focusrite's products.
Global economic growth is crucial for Focusrite's success, as it drives demand for its audio equipment. In 2024, the IMF projected global growth at 3.2%, a slight increase from 2023. Recession risks, however, persist. A downturn could reduce consumer spending on non-essential items like audio gear, impacting Focusrite's revenue and profits. For instance, a 1% drop in global GDP could lead to a noticeable decrease in sales.
Focusrite faces currency risks due to its global operations. Fluctuating exchange rates affect component costs and product competitiveness. For example, a stronger pound in 2024/2025 could make imports cheaper but exports pricier. This impacts international sales revenue, as seen in varying financial reports.

Sociological factors
The surge in content creation, encompassing music, podcasts, and videos, fuels demand for audio tools. This trend, with platforms like YouTube and Spotify, sees millions of creators. Statista projects the global audio equipment market to reach $35.3 billion by 2025. Focusrite benefits from this expansion.
Changing consumer preferences significantly shape Focusrite's strategies. Demand for portable, integrated audio solutions is rising. The global portable audio market was valued at $36.9 billion in 2024, projected to reach $52.8 billion by 2029. Wireless audio's popularity also impacts the market; Bluetooth audio device sales grew by 15% in 2024. Focusrite must adapt to these trends.

Technological factors
Focusrite must stay ahead in digital audio. Innovations in processing, interfaces, and reproduction are key. The global audio equipment market, valued at $28.5 billion in 2024, is expected to reach $36.2 billion by 2029. This growth highlights the need for advanced tech.
The rise of sophisticated DAWs, like Ableton Live and Logic Pro X, shapes Focusrite's product development. Compatibility with these platforms is crucial; Focusrite's interfaces must seamlessly integrate. In 2024, the global music production software market was valued at $1.5 billion. Focusrite's ability to adapt to software updates directly impacts its market share, which reached 12% in 2024.
The audio industry's embrace of AI is accelerating. Focusrite must integrate AI for processing and content creation. In 2024, the AI in audio market was valued at $1.2 billion, projected to reach $4.5 billion by 2029. This growth presents both opportunities and competitive pressures for Focusrite.

Legal factors
Focusrite relies on patents, trademarks, and copyrights to protect its audio technology. Strong IP helps maintain its competitive edge. For instance, in 2024, the global music production software market was valued at $2.3 billion. These laws are crucial for market success. This legal protection fosters innovation and brand recognition.
Focusrite faces product safety and compliance regulations globally. These include electrical safety standards like IEC 62368-1. For example, in 2024, the global audio equipment market was valued at approximately $25 billion, and compliance costs can impact profitability. Ensuring compliance is critical for market access.
Focusrite must comply with data protection laws like GDPR, especially regarding customer data collected through software and online services. GDPR compliance involves stringent rules on data handling, including consent, data security, and breach notification. A 2024 report indicates that GDPR fines totaled over €1.6 billion, emphasizing the importance of compliance. Focusrite faces legal and reputational risks if it fails to protect user data.

Environmental factors
Focusrite actively pursues environmental sustainability, targeting carbon-neutral operations and products. They focus on eco-friendly product design and sustainable material sourcing. Recent data shows a 15% reduction in waste in 2024 and a 10% cut in energy use. These efforts align with the growing market demand for environmentally responsible brands.
Focusrite faces growing pressure to adopt sustainable materials. Using recycled plastics and metals reduces waste and appeals to eco-conscious consumers. The global market for sustainable packaging is projected to reach $435.2 billion by 2027. This shift can enhance brand image and potentially lower long-term costs.
Focusrite's commitment involves boosting energy efficiency in its products and facilities. The company assesses renewable energy options. Globally, energy consumption in electronics manufacturing is significant. The audio equipment market is worth billions. Focusrite's strategies align with broader sustainability goals.
Waste Management and Product Lifecycle
Focusrite, like all manufacturers, must manage waste responsibly and consider its products' full lifecycles to reduce environmental impact. This includes efficient manufacturing processes to minimize waste generation, choosing sustainable materials, and designing products for durability and recyclability. Proper end-of-life management involves facilitating recycling programs and reducing electronic waste. The global e-waste generation reached 62 million tonnes in 2022.
